Overview
Revenue Management Manager
Responsible for pricing strategy, pricing policy, pack-price architecture, and mix management.
Responsibilities
Key responsibilities
- Define and implement pricing strategy and pricing policies across channels and customers.
- Develop and maintain optimal pack-price architecture to ensure clear consumer value ladders and maximize category profitability.
- Drive mix management initiatives to improve revenue, margin, and portfolio performance.
- Identify pricing and assortment opportunities based on market trends, consumer behavior, and competitive dynamics.
- Lead revenue optimization projects, including price increases, promotional effectiveness, and portfolio rationalization.
- Monitor category performance, analyze key revenue drivers, and provide actionable recommendations to senior management.
- Collaborate closely with Sales, Marketing, Finance, and Commercialization teams to align commercial strategies and business objectives.
- Support annual business planning delivering revenue growth initiatives
Qualifications
Key Qualifications
- Minimum 5 years of experience in Revenue Growth Management, Pricing, or Commercial Strategy, preferably within FMCG.
- Additional experience in Sales, Trade Marketing, Consumer Insights, Category Management, or Commercial Finance will be considered a strong advantage.
- Proven expertise in pricing strategy, pricing execution, pack-price architecture, and mix management.
- Strong analytical and financial acumen with the ability to translate complex data into actionable business recommendations.
- Experience in identifying growth opportunities and driving revenue and profitability improvement initiatives.
- Strong stakeholder management and influencing skills, with the ability to work effectively across Sales, Marketing, Finance, and Supply Chain functions.
- Advanced Excel and data analysis capabilities required
- Excellent communication and presentation skills.
- Results-oriented mindset with strong project management and prioritization capabilities.
- Fluent English & Polish, both written and spoken.
